Just an FYI: I got an email from DroneBase last Thursday wanting me to fly in San Francisco the following day. Wanting me to shoot footage of Ocean Beach and Lands End (from outside the Golden Gate National Recreation Area restricted airspace because OB and LE are no drone zones) and also some footage of the Richmond District flying down and around Clement Street. Required: seven 30 second video clips and at least 10 photos for each drop. Pay: $270 for all of it?!?!? This makes absolutely no financial sense for me to do whatsoever especially given the air space challenges, congested city and parking issues so I had to pass. Plus, I'm not even sure I could get good footage of OB and LE from outside the no fly zone. And DB would sell the stunning aerial footage of San Francisco for a lot of money... over and over and over again. For these three particular shoots DB is attempting to woefully underpay the PIC.
